Home to Roost: Used SUVs Will Hurt Leasing Companies
A tidal wave of used SUVs coming off leases will cost auto lenders as much as an estimated $4.9 billion this year, and similar amounts again in 2009 and 2010. That's according to CNW Marketing Research, a longtime specialist in auto lease data. "Three...

SDLT and Informal Occupation
Before 1 December 2003, a new lease of UK land was subject to stamp duty. Leases would often be kept offshore and left unstamped, or the parties might rely on an agreement for lease, the lease proper being granted and stamped only when needed for other purposes. This article attempts...
